Understanding Treadmills with Incline
A treadmill with an incline feature enables users to reproduce the results of walking or running uphill, a considerable upgrade over basic flat treadmills. The incline can often be adjusted digitally, permitting varying levels of trouble. Users can pick a series of incline levels to personalize their exercise, targeting various muscles and increasing caloric expense.
Advantages of Using a Home Treadmill with Incline
Increased Caloric Burn: Incline running requires more energy than working on a flat surface. Studies suggest that walking or performing at an incline can burn 30-40% more calories, making it an efficient option for weight-loss and physical fitness goals.

Muscle Engagement: Incline walking engages larger muscle groups, particularly the glutes, hamstrings, and calves. This can improve muscle tone and strength compared to flat running.

Joint Impact Reduction: Treadmills are designed with shock-absorbing functions, which can decrease the impact on joints compared to running on tough surface areas. An incline can further minimize impact by permitting a more natural gait.

Varied Workouts: Treadmills with incline abilities offer the chance to blend up an exercise regimen. Users can include interval training, endurance runs, and incline walks, keeping exercises fresh and interesting.

Inspiration: Many treadmills come with integrated workout programs that include incline workouts. This adds an aspect of inspiration, as users can follow a structured routine without needing to prepare it themselves.
Key Features to Look For in Home Treadmills with Incline
When selecting a treadmill that suits your requirements, it's essential to consider different features that can improve your exercise experience. Here's a list to simplify your decision-making procedure:
1. Incline RangeInspect the optimum incline provided (generally between 10-15%).Some advanced designs can replicate downhill running too.2. Motor PowerA more effective motor (a minimum of 3.0 CHP) can provide smoother performance, especially when the incline increases.3. Running SurfaceLook for a deck size that fits your stride length, usually around 55-60 inches long.4. Built-in ProgramsPrograms created for interval training or hill exercises can make your sessions more structured and effective.5. Connectivity FeaturesBluetooth, apps compatibility, and speakers enhance the exercise experience, allowing users to listen to music or follow workout apps.6. Display ConsoleEnsure it is user-friendly and reveals essential stats like speed, incline, distance, and calories burned.7. FoldabilityIf area is an issue, consider a model that can be easily folded for storage.8. A1: Running on an incline is frequently considered better for fitness goals as it increases calorie burn and muscle engagement. Moreover, it can reduce the threat of injury due to lower impact on joints.
Q2: How typically should I use a treadmill with incline to see results?
A2: It is normally recommended to integrate treadmill workouts into your regular 3-5 times each week. Blending incline workouts with other forms of workout can improve outcomes and avoid dullness.
Q3: Can I utilize a treadmill with incline for walking rather of running?
A3: Absolutely! Incline walking is an outstanding low-impact exercise that is advantageous for individuals of all fitness levels. It can be particularly beneficial for those recovering from injuries.
Q4: Are home treadmills with incline suitable for novices?
A4: Yes, numerous treadmills come with easy to use functions designed for novices. Users can begin at a lower incline and gradually increase as fitness enhances.
Q5: What safety preventative measures should I take when using a treadmill?
A5: Always heat up before exercising, stay hydrated, and make certain the treadmill is put on a stable surface area. Monitor your heart rate and utilize the safety secret to stop the machine in case of emergency situations.
